Purpose
This standard describes the recommended basic
requirements for safe working on railway tracks
Procedures
Florescent safety jackets to be used by all persons working
on track line
Engineering works on non-electrified line
Track Inspection : To be carried out by 2 persons. One will
inspect and other will be present to look for the safety of the
inspecting person. The person on watch should have Red
Flag
Job of short duration: All the jobs which can be completed
without interrupting rolling stocks. Permit of work
clearance to be taken. Red Banner to be put at 40 feet away
on both ends from working point. Any rolling stock should
stop before the flags
Engineering work on non electrified line
Job of long duration: If rolling stock will be
interrupted then it’s a long duration job. Proper
shutdown should be taken from proper authority. Red
Banner to be put at 40 feet away on both ends from
working point. Any rolling stock should stop before the
flags. If there is a risk of interference with from trains
on adjacent rail tracks workers shouldn’t be allowed to
walk on that line
Engineering work on non electrified line
Laying of new line and connection with existing:
The new line should be laid first without affecting the
existing line. Before executing the new line will be
jointly inspected by the executing agency and PWE.
After inspection, connection will be done by taking a
proper shutdown. Red Banner to be put at 40 feet away
on both ends from working point. Any rolling stock
should stop before the flags. If there is a risk of
interference from trains on adjacent rail tracks workers
shouldn’t be allowed to walk on that line
Engineering work on electrical track line
All the categories mentioned before are applicable
No damage should be caused to traction bonds during the job
Distance between track components, electric masts and OHE
wires should be within prescribed tolerances
Without power block, no work within a distance of 2m from
live parts of OHE
New steel material at 200 m from running rail
During movement of Electric Loco: No body should be in
contact with the track within 250m distance
Insulated tools and gloves should be used
Engineering work on Signaling & Interlocking
Proper maintenance of insulated joints
All switches and their connectivity with signaling
system to be checked weekly
No metallic tool near signal wire
No metallic handle umbrella to be used near traction
line
Proper coordination with cabin while checking the
guage
Engineering work on Bridge/High line
All previous instruction applicable
Full body harness to be used while working on bridge
No loose material to be kept on scape platform
Spike structure to be used to remove dog spike
Engineering work on hot metal line & coke plant
Fire Retardant jacket to be used while working on Hot
Metal line & Coke Plant area. Nobody should go in front
of cast house during taping of hot metal and slag.
Nobody should enter the quenching tower area in coke
plant without proper clearance.
